What is the Missouri Correction Statement and Agreement?

The Missouri Correction Statement and Agreement is a critical document in real estate transactions, specifically designed to rectify errors or inaccuracies in closing documents. This form ensures that both parties can correct any discrepancies that arise, safeguarding the integrity of their transaction.
The necessity of this form cannot be overstated, as it effectively handles errors that may compromise the legitimacy of closing documents. Both Seller(s) and Buyer(s) are required to sign this agreement, emphasizing its importance in validating the corrections made.

Key Features of the Missouri Correction Statement and Agreement

The Missouri Correction Statement and Agreement possesses several distinct characteristics that facilitate its use. Key components include clearly defined fields such as 'COUNTY OF ______________' and designated signature lines for both parties.
Additionally, the notarization requirement adds a layer of authenticity, ensuring that the document is legally binding. The form also incorporates checkboxes to enhance user experience, making it simpler to fill out accurately.

Who Needs the Missouri Correction Statement and Agreement?

This correction statement is essential for both Sellers and Buyers in Missouri when addressing errors in their transactions. It is particularly crucial in scenarios where documents may have been lost or destroyed. Additionally, other parties involved in the transaction, such as real estate agents or brokers, may also find this form beneficial in ensuring all documents are accurate and reliable.
